Hi John,

Lift the passengers seat to access the engine and the plate is clearly visable there, my van is the SWB version and just slips under the LEZ 2500 kg gross weight at 2490 kg, so I think the your daughters LWB base version will be over the 2500 KG requirement.

Ps there should be a gross weight shown on the V5 document.

We're getting the conversion done as we live in London. Its going to come in at about £2000 ish I think. You could fit one yourself assuming the makers are willing to sell to you.
You will then have to take it to a garage and pay them to test it and register that with the LEZ people/VOSA. Again assuming they will test a fitting that they haven't done themselves.

er I'm assuming this vehicle has to either be parked in london or travel thru london?
If not don;t worry about this as you will still be able to drive round the M25 without a filter.

If you do need a filter suppliers are listed here http://www.tfl.gov.uk/assets/downloads/roadusers/lez/Approved-device-list.pdf

We are using Hackney Truck Repairs, cant remember which filter make I'm afraid. Not very convenient to Wimbourne but any of the filter suppliers listed will point you to a southern fitter.

Hi Milkman,

I assume that your van is over the 2500 KG gross vehicle weight cut off. If not and if your are the same as my conversion which shows 2490 KG on the V5 document , then like me you may not need the filter.

LEZ have confirmed to me in writing that as mine is a Motor Cravan and under 2500 KG no filter is required Very Happy

Certainly worth you looking into if you have'nt already.

Hi everybody
Have just contacted the DVLA and they said as my vehicle reg. before 2001 it is automatically classes as Private light goods. They would be willing to change it to MPV if I send a picture and say that its used for private only.
LEZ London state that MPV's are exempt and the weight does not come into any consideration. I have already booked the vehicle in for a filter and now hope to cancel it once the dvla have changed the spec.

wafoo wrote:
LEZ London state that MPV's are exempt

provided that they have nine seats or less. basically it's the same rules as "minibus". you will need to make sure that the V5 says the number of seats because when the TFL people see MPV they then look for number of seats and provided it is 1-9 you are okay
